As a Juvenile Counselor, the person will supervise, guide and counsel the troubled youth for a better future. Essential roles and responsibilities pertaining to this role are listed on the Juvenile Counselor Resume as follows – taking responsibility for providing supervision, care and counseling to the Juvenile detainees, working to detect the behavioral issues or criminal histories, visiting the juvenile’s home or school or workplace to assess the progress of the youth; providing counseling and assistance throughout the time they are in the correctional program.
To guide and lead the juveniles in the right direction, the Counselor should possess the following skills and abilities – knowledge of psychology, sociology and therapeutic techniques; strong communication skills, strong math skills; the ability to test the applicant’s skill in reading comprehension and writing; and loads of patience. To work at this capacity, the person should have a degree in degree in areas like social work or psychology.
